Empty valid_status_codes defaults to 2xx only, not "any".
Explicitly list common status codes (2xx, 3xx, 4xx, 5xx) so
services returning 400/401 like ha and nzbget pass the probe.

The template used | min(100) | max(0) which is invalid Jinja2 syntax.
These filters expect iterables (lists), not scalar arguments. This
caused TypeError warnings on every MQTT message and left battery
sensors unavailable.
Fixed by using proper list-based min/max:
[[[value, 100] | min, 0] | max

The 2-hour threshold was too aggressive for temperature sensors in
stable environments. Historical data shows gaps up to 2.75 hours when
temperature hasn't changed (Home Assistant only updates last_updated
when values change). Increasing to 4 hours avoids false positives
while still catching genuine failures.
